Port Esportiu de Ca’n Picafort
Port Esportiu de Ca’n Picafort is a marina in Balearic Islands, Spain. Port Esportiu de Ca’n Picafort is situated nearby to the square Plaça d’en Jaume Mandilego Buchens, as well as near the tourism office Oficina de Turisme de Ca’n Picafort.Places of Interest Nearby

Alcanada
Village
The former ancient Muslim farmstead of Alcanada, is today known as a traditional summer holiday spot, with a beach without sand, a golf-course and a small island with a lighthouse. Alcanada is situated 8 km north of Port Esportiu de Ca’n Picafort.
Port d’Alcudia
Suburb
Photo: Davidpar,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Port d'Alcudia is a town and tourist resort in North East Majorca. It neighbours the town of Alcúdia and has many hotels and tourist venues located within the town. Port d’Alcudia is situated 9 km north of Port Esportiu de Ca’n Picafort.
